5. To obtain more working room, remove fans 2 and 3 (see “Removing a
hot-swap fan” on page 127).
6. Pull the hard disk drives or fillers out of the server slightly to disengage them
from the backplanes. For more information, see“Removing a hard disk drive”
on page 62.
7. Disconnect the SAS signal cable from the SAS controller, which is connected to
the SAS riser-card. Leave the other end of the SAS signal cable connected to
the hard disk drive backplane.
8. Remove the SAS controller assembly from the server; then, remove the SAS
controller from the SAS riser-card. See “Removing a ServeRAID SAS controller
from the SAS riser-card” on page 134 for instructions.
